steel will be stiffer and cheaper. 6063-T6 that has been welded is 6063-O (annealed)
if its been welded (and of course not artificially aged after) that will be no stiffer than steel per unit of weight.
when will people learn, STEEL IS NOT HEAVIER THAN ALUMINIUM FOR THE SAME STRENGTH or stiffness. unless it is heat treated/Aged.
however that bar might not be welded to the strut tower mounts, in which case 6063-T6 is some goooooooood stuff!
